Abstract

The Agricultural Fertilizer Tech-Rover is a wireless-controlled rover designed to improve fertilizer application in small-scale farming. Small farms often struggle with labor-intensive tasks, uneven fertilizer distribution, and limited access to modern technology, which can lead to inefficiencies, lower crop yields, and higher costs. This rover addresses these challenges by offering an easy-to-use, mobile-controlled solution that increases fertilizer application accuracy.

Using Bluetooth technology, the rover can be controlled remotely through a mobile app, reducing physical effort for farmers and improving efficiency. It is powered by solar energy and can also use an optional electric charging system, making it perfect for areas with limited electricity. The rover’s flexible design helps optimize resource use, boost crop yields, and promote sustainable farming practices.

The goal of this project is to provide small-scale farmers with affordable, effective tools that enhance productivity, support sustainability, and strengthen food security.
